Summary: When making cross-study comparisons, the onus of using a consistent methodology is on the investigator to allow for proper comparisons to be made. ›Here, we offer an unbiased methodology that can be applied consistently across studies with no more information needed than that given in a simple contingency table. ›Overall, we found no statistically significant differences in the ranges of 23-GEP sensitivity, specificity, PPV, or NPV between previous
studies and the Boothby-Shoemaker et. al. cohort with this unified methodological approach. ›This study further confirms that the real-world accuracy of the 23-GEP in diagnostically ambiguous lesions is remarkably similar to that of previous validation studies.
